The Condensate Pump in Giant Boiler Systems
In Giant boiler equipment, the Condensate Pump removes acidic condensation produced by high-efficiency condensing boilers. Giant designs their condensate pump components to work with their proprietary technology, including Canadian-engineered for cold incoming water temperatures, powered anode rod for extended life, high-altitude kit available for BC, Canadian-made steel tank construction. When this component fails, it can trigger error codes, cause the system to shut down, or result in inefficient operation. Common Symptoms of Giant Condensate Pump Failure
Giant boiler owners may notice several warning signs when the condensate pump is failing. These include specific Giant error codes on the control board or thermostat, the system failing to start or cycling on and off, unusual noises during operation, reduced heating performance, and increased energy consumption. Safety Reminder
If you smell gas, suspect carbon monoxide or believe there is an immediate danger, leave the property and contact emergency services or the appropriate gas emergency authority. Do not remain inside — exit the building immediately and call for help from outside.
